Transaction 58324641637ace1205386ee233cd625c848bda8d3bd21480bba57bde759a5c2b
1 Input
1 Output
-
58324641637ace1205386ee233cd625c848bda8d3bd21480bba57bde759a5c2b:0
- value
- 1741149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2871d7e2d4a7b4a856eab8fff05b56c3873682a8 OP_EQUAL
- address
- 35NsLBtFpkgbt5hiuyQFkd6rjnzZ6pDpsC